U.K. no-frills carrier EasyJet has signed a contract with FLS Aerospace to provide total maintenance support for its 737 fleet, which is expected to grow to 38 aircraft by 2003. The contract is estimated to be worth 77 million pounds ($128 million) over the next seven years. A light maintenance...
